The AI implementation advisory market now shows a clear separation between those with simple access to tools and those with real implementation capability. Recent research by the Swiss Institute of Artificial Intelligence shows that businesses with extensive and sophisticated AI consumption experienced a weekly outperformance of 64.1 basis points compared to those with limited or occasional use. The difference does not come from the possession of licenses, but from the depth of integration into the operational processes. At the same time, Eurostat data show that 55% of large European companies were using artificial intelligence in 2025, compared to just 17% of small ones, a distance that mainly reflects the cost of implementation rather than the cost of access to technology. That gap is now where consulting firms compete. Boutique specialists have been handed an opening and larger firms have been pushed to rethink their offer.
Beyond Access: Where the Gap Really Lies
Obtaining a license for an AI model is currently a cheap and fast process. Connecting this model to real-world data, workflows and accountability structures remains challenging and time-consuming. Implementation is described, in research by the Swiss Institute of Artificial Intelligence, as an intermediate organizational layer between access and productive use, one that requires skills, access rules, interfaces and evaluation criteria no model arrives with.

The same research records that market pricing seems to reward businesses that consume AI in an intensive, specialized and repetitive way, rather than those that simply have licenses. Installation, system integration and persuasion skills currently appear to have a more positive exposure to the market than purely analytical skills, which is attributed to the fact that implementation remains the scarce raw material of the current phase of technology diffusion.

Seventy Percent of the Value Lies in People
A survey by Boston Consulting Group of hundreds of companies comes up with an indicative ratio: only 10% of the value resulting from artificial intelligence projects is attributed to the algorithms themselves, 20% to the technology of their implementation and the remaining 70% to the restructuring of the human factor. Companies described by the study as fully developed in this sector are planning to have more than half of their workforce upskilled, compared to just 20% in companies that lag behind and record an average shareholder return of about four times over three years.
Why Consultants Remain Irreplaceable
The rapid adoption of AI tools by major consulting firms has not reduced the demand for human judgment, but instead seems to be shifting it towards more complex tasks. The skills analysis accompanying the AI premium findings shows positive exposure to persuasion, coordination and institutional action skills, while purely analytical skills show negative exposure as analysis production becomes cheaper. A model can produce the analysis. Someone still has to own the decision.
This partly explains why organizations still pay for human consulting even when technology can first produce draft reports or analytics within minutes. Consulting's value is shifting from producing content to validating it, managing change and signing off on decisions; work automation hasn't touched it yet.
Boutiques vs. Traditional Groups: A Market That Is Being Rearranged
In the ranking for AI and data implementation consulting, the first tier is dominated by niche names like Palantir Technologies, Databricks through its services, Fractal, Quantiphi and Tredence, companies built around technical immersion in data and machine learning rather than traditional management consulting. Large global consulting groups are explicitly excluded by the ranking methodology itself, a sign of how far the technical implementation market has drifted from traditional management consulting.
In the digital transformation category, companies such as Slalom, Thoughtworks, Globant, Publicis Sapient and Valtech are leading, while in the business technology consulting category, independent agencies such as Avasant, ISG, Info-Tech Research Group, Metis Strategy and West Monroe are leading the way. The common element between these three categories is the absence of the largest traditional groups from the top positions, not because they lack technological investment, but because these rankings evaluate purely technical deepening of implementation and not wider organizational influence.

The Next Stage of AI Implementation Advisory
Research by the Swiss Institute of Artificial Intelligence predicts that the current advantage of specialized implementation companies is transient. As platforms, connections and implementation practices become standardized, the scarcity of purely technical installation is expected to decrease, shifting the competitive advantage towards quality of use, i.e., what tasks are assigned to models, how results are verified and how workflows are reconfigured. In this transitional phase, traditional groups, with long-standing experience in human resource reorganization and institutional change, possess exactly the skills that seventy percent of the value seems to require.
That gap in the market: access alone doesn't earn it, deep integration does. The consulting firms that will lead the next phase will not necessarily be those who possess the most advanced technical tools, but those who can combine the technical ability of implementation with the deep knowledge of human resources restructuring. Firms hiring for AI implementation now need to check both boxes, technical depth and workforce experience, or risk picking the wrong partner.
